WebThe main advantages of nitroglycerin are its relatively rapid onset of action (minutes), lack of tachyphylaxis and toxicity, and brief duration of action (minutes); the major disadvantage is the limited achievable reduction in blood pressure. Dosage. Nitroglycerin is administered by an infusion beginning at a rate of 1 µg/kg per minute; the ... WebSep 16, 2003 · Nitroglycerin achieves its salutary action both by dilating coronary vessels and by decreasing the heart’s workload. The latter is accomplished by reducing peripheral return of blood to the heart, as well as by lessening the resistance to the outflow of blood from the heart into the main arterial circulation.
